Central to this framework is the philosophical concept of value pluralism, an idea that suggests individuals inherently hold multiple values that are not only equally valid but also frequently stand in direct opposition to one another. Unlike monistic views that seek a single overarching good, value pluralism acknowledges the rich tapestry of human motivations.

Consider, for instance, the conflict between personal ambition and familial obligations, or the tension between individual liberty and collective well-being. These scenarios are not mere intellectual exercises but real-life struggles where deeply held ethical principles clash, leaving individuals grappling with profound uncertainty.

navigating-lifes-hardest-choices-a-guide-to-moral-dilemmas-images-1

The challenge is not to find a universally “correct” answer, but rather to develop a method for thoughtfully engaging with these inherent value conflicts. This involves recognizing the legitimacy of each value at play, understanding their nuances, and accepting that some choices may involve sacrificing one good for another, rather than achieving a perfect synthesis.

By adopting a value pluralist perspective, individuals can move beyond the paralysis of indecision, gaining clarity on the underlying ethical tensions that make certain choices so arduous. It provides a lens through which to analyze the trade-offs involved, empowering a more deliberate and informed decision-making process, even when no easy answer presents itself.
